Job Summary:The Municipal Court Violations Technician reports to the Municipal Court Administrator. The role is responsible for data entry, case scheduling, payment processing, daily reconciliation of traffic/criminal accounts and preparation of daily deposits. Provides customer service to the public by way of phone, email and written correspondence in addition to handling all in-person traffic at the violations window. Answers public inquiries on traffic and criminal matters and provides direction and procedural guidance to the public. Part time hours up to 29 hours, Monday through Friday.

Education, Certifications and Licenses:
● Graduation from High School or Vocational High School, or possession of an approved High School Equivalency Certificate
● Current certification as a Municipal Court Administrator issued by the New Jersey Supreme Court pursuant to NJSA 2B:12-11 may be substituted for the indicated experience
● Although certification is not required, a violations clerk must successfully complete Principles of Municipal Court Administration I and II as required by the New Jersey State Judiciary
Certification Not Required, but Preferred “Effective September 13, 2011, all newly appointed deputy municipal court administrators, who are not certified municipal court administrators pursuant to N.J.S.A. 2B:12-11, must obtain conditional accreditation within six (6) months of the date of appointment. All newly appointed, non-certified deputy municipal court administrators must obtain full accreditation within three (3) years of the date of appointment. A non-certified deputy municipal court administrator, who fails to obtain conditional accreditation or accreditation within the time frames provided above will be ineligible to remain in that title. The Municipal Court Administrator Certification Board may grant an extension of time upon a showing of good cause.
